Thanks everyone for participating in my poll.
Based on everything I have read on this forum, the results of this poll are exactly as I expected, with the 359's emerging as the overwhelming favorite. I have come to realize that there are a lot of OEM purists on here that are loyal to the OEM wheels and feel like the 359s and 219s were designed with this car in mind. As they should, they are outstanding wheels for sure. However, having owned all three, the 359's and 219's (while really nice) IMHO are not as nice as the LM-Rs. On a side note, I do think the LM-Rs are much better in person than in the pics...not to mention they are infinately easier to clean. To me the LM-Rs are perfection and once I add 12 or 15mm spacers to the fronts in the spring, they will be perfect. As you know, when buying used, you can not always dictate your offsets. They are ET 28s on 8.5" wheels, 359s are ET 25 on 9.0" wheels, nothing a quick spacer can't sure up.
